Mrs. Estella Butcher was born August 18, 1877 in Murphysboro, the daughter of Hugh and Alize Rolens Broom. Her surviving siblings were Alpha Rolens of Murphysboro and Dr. M. E. Rolens of Springfield. Seven brothers and sisters preceded her in death.
She married Alpha butcher in 1899; he died in 1941. She left children, Mrs. Ilean Gardner and Waldo Butcher of Murphysboro. She was preceded in death by a son and a daughter.
Mrs. Butcher was a lifelong Murphysboro resident. She was a member of the First Baptist Church in Murphysboro.
She died at the age of 86 at the home of her daughter, Mrs. Ilean Gardner after a long illness. His funeral service was held at First Baptist Church. Rev. Harry R. Chasteen officiated. Meyer-Denny Funeral Home was in charge of arrangements.
Source: Obituary, Southern Illinoisan, Thursday, March 26, 1964
